Dela via


NamespacesOperations Klass

Varning

Instansiera INTE den här klassen direkt.

I stället bör du komma åt följande åtgärder via

EventGridManagementClient's

<xref:namespaces> Attributet.

Arv
builtins.object
NamespacesOperations

Konstruktor

NamespacesOperations(*args, **kwargs)

Metoder

begin_create_or_update

Skapa eller uppdatera ett namnområde.

Asynkront skapar eller uppdaterar ett nytt namnområde med de angivna parametrarna.

begin_delete

Ta bort ett namnområde.

Ta bort befintligt namnområde.

begin_regenerate_key

Återskapa nyckeln för ett namnområde.

Återskapa en delad åtkomstnyckel för ett namnområde.

begin_update

Uppdatera ett namnområde.

Asynkront uppdaterar ett namnområde med de angivna parametrarna.

get

Hämta ett namnområde.

Hämta egenskaper för ett namnområde.

list_by_resource_group

Lista namnområden under en resursgrupp.

Visa en lista över alla namnområden under en resursgrupp.

list_by_subscription

Lista namnområden under en Azure-prenumeration.

Visa en lista över alla namnområden under en Azure-prenumeration.

list_shared_access_keys

Listnycklar för ett namnområde.

Visa en lista över de två nycklar som används för att publicera till ett namnområde.

begin_create_or_update

Skapa eller uppdatera ett namnområde.

Asynkront skapar eller uppdaterar ett nytt namnområde med de angivna parametrarna.

begin_create_or_update(resource_group_name: str, namespace_name: str, namespace_info: _models.Namespace, *, content_type: str = 'application/json', **kwargs: Any) -> LROPoller[_models.Namespace]

Parametrar

resource_group_name
str
Obligatorisk

Namnet på resursgruppen i användarens prenumeration. Krävs.

namespace_name
str
Obligatorisk

Namn på namnområdet. Krävs.

namespace_info
Namespace eller IO
Obligatorisk

Namnområdesinformation. Är antingen en namnområdestyp eller en I/O-typ. Krävs.

content_type
str

Innehållstyp för brödtextparameter. Kända värden är: "application/json". Standardvärdet är Ingen.

cls
callable

En anpassad typ eller funktion som skickas direktsvaret

continuation_token
str

En fortsättningstoken för att starta om en poller från ett sparat tillstånd.

polling
bool eller PollingMethod

Som standard är avsökningsmetoden ARMPolling. Skicka in Falskt för att den här åtgärden inte ska avsökas eller skicka in ditt eget initierade avsökningsobjekt för en personlig avsökningsstrategi.

polling_interval
int

Standardväntetid mellan två omröstningar för LRO-åtgärder om det inte finns någon Retry-After huvud.

Returer

En instans av LROPoller som returnerar antingen Namnområde eller resultatet av cls(svar)

Returtyp

Undantag

begin_delete

Ta bort ett namnområde.

Ta bort befintligt namnområde.

begin_delete(resource_group_name: str, namespace_name: str, **kwargs: Any) -> LROPoller[None]

Parametrar

resource_group_name
str
Obligatorisk

Namnet på resursgruppen i användarens prenumeration. Krävs.

namespace_name
str
Obligatorisk

Namn på namnområdet. Krävs.

cls
callable

En anpassad typ eller funktion som skickas direktsvaret

continuation_token
str

En fortsättningstoken för att starta om en poller från ett sparat tillstånd.

polling
bool eller PollingMethod

Som standard är avsökningsmetoden ARMPolling. Skicka in Falskt för att den här åtgärden inte ska avsökas eller skicka in ditt eget initierade avsökningsobjekt för en personlig avsökningsstrategi.

polling_interval
int

Standardväntetid mellan två omröstningar för LRO-åtgärder om det inte finns någon Retry-After huvud.

Returer

En instans av LROPoller som returnerar antingen None eller resultatet av cls(response)

Returtyp

Undantag

begin_regenerate_key

Återskapa nyckeln för ett namnområde.

Återskapa en delad åtkomstnyckel för ett namnområde.

begin_regenerate_key(resource_group_name: str, namespace_name: str, regenerate_key_request: _models.NamespaceRegenerateKeyRequest, *, content_type: str = 'application/json', **kwargs: Any) -> LROPoller[_models.NamespaceSharedAccessKeys]

Parametrar

resource_group_name
str
Obligatorisk

Namnet på resursgruppen i användarens prenumeration. Krävs.

namespace_name
str
Obligatorisk

Namn på namnområdet. Krävs.

regenerate_key_request
NamespaceRegenerateKeyRequest eller IO
Obligatorisk

Begär brödtext för att återskapa nyckeln. Är antingen en NamespaceRegenerateKeyRequest-typ eller en I/O-typ. Krävs.

content_type
str

Innehållstyp för brödtextparameter. Kända värden är: "application/json". Standardvärdet är Ingen.

cls
callable

En anpassad typ eller funktion som skickas direktsvaret

continuation_token
str

En fortsättningstoken för att starta om en poller från ett sparat tillstånd.

polling
bool eller PollingMethod

Som standard är avsökningsmetoden ARMPolling. Skicka in Falskt för att den här åtgärden inte ska avsökas eller skicka in ditt eget initierade avsökningsobjekt för en personlig avsökningsstrategi.

polling_interval
int

Standardväntetid mellan två omröstningar för LRO-åtgärder om det inte finns någon Retry-After huvud.

Returer

En instans av LROPoller som returnerar antingen NamespaceSharedAccessKeys eller resultatet av cls(response)

Returtyp

Undantag

begin_update

Uppdatera ett namnområde.

Asynkront uppdaterar ett namnområde med de angivna parametrarna.

begin_update(resource_group_name: str, namespace_name: str, namespace_update_parameters: _models.NamespaceUpdateParameters, *, content_type: str = 'application/json', **kwargs: Any) -> LROPoller[_models.Namespace]

Parametrar

resource_group_name
str
Obligatorisk

Namnet på resursgruppen i användarens prenumeration. Krävs.

namespace_name
str
Obligatorisk

Namn på namnområdet. Krävs.

namespace_update_parameters
NamespaceUpdateParameters eller IO
Obligatorisk

Uppdateringsinformation för namnområde. Är antingen en NamespaceUpdateParameters-typ eller en I/O-typ. Krävs.

content_type
str

Innehållstyp för brödtextparameter. Kända värden är: "application/json". Standardvärdet är Ingen.

cls
callable

En anpassad typ eller funktion som skickas direktsvaret

continuation_token
str

En fortsättningstoken för att starta om en poller från ett sparat tillstånd.

polling
bool eller PollingMethod

Som standard är avsökningsmetoden ARMPolling. Skicka in Falskt för att den här åtgärden inte ska avsökas eller skicka in ditt eget initierade avsökningsobjekt för en personlig avsökningsstrategi.

polling_interval
int

Standardväntetid mellan två omröstningar för LRO-åtgärder om det inte finns någon Retry-After huvud.

Returer

En instans av LROPoller som returnerar antingen Namnområde eller resultatet av cls(svar)

Returtyp

Undantag

get

Hämta ett namnområde.

Hämta egenskaper för ett namnområde.

get(resource_group_name: str, namespace_name: str, **kwargs: Any) -> Namespace

Parametrar

resource_group_name
str
Obligatorisk

Namnet på resursgruppen i användarens prenumeration. Krävs.

namespace_name
str
Obligatorisk

Namn på namnområdet. Krävs.

cls
callable

En anpassad typ eller funktion som skickas direktsvaret

Returer

Namnområde eller resultatet av cls(svar)

Returtyp

Undantag

list_by_resource_group

Lista namnområden under en resursgrupp.

Visa en lista över alla namnområden under en resursgrupp.

list_by_resource_group(resource_group_name: str, filter: str | None = None, top: int | None = None, **kwargs: Any) -> Iterable[Namespace]

Parametrar

resource_group_name
str
Obligatorisk

Namnet på resursgruppen i användarens prenumeration. Krävs.

filter
str
Obligatorisk

Frågan som används för att filtrera sökresultaten med OData-syntax. Filtrering tillåts endast för egenskapen "name" och med ett begränsat antal OData-åtgärder. Dessa åtgärder är: funktionen "contains" samt följande logiska åtgärder: inte, och, eller, eq (för lika med) och ne (för inte lika med). Inga aritmetiska åtgärder stöds. Följande är ett giltigt filterexempel: $filter=contains(namE, 'PATTERN') och name ne 'PATTERN-1'. Följande är inte ett giltigt filterexempel: $filter=location eq 'westus'. Standardvärdet är Ingen.

top
int
Obligatorisk

Antalet resultat som ska returneras per sida för liståtgärden. Det giltiga intervallet för den översta parametern är 1 till 100. Om inget anges är standardantalet resultat som ska returneras 20 objekt per sida. Standardvärdet är Ingen.

cls
callable

En anpassad typ eller funktion som skickas direktsvaret

Returer

En iterator som en instans av antingen Namnområde eller resultatet av cls(svar)

Returtyp

Undantag

list_by_subscription

Lista namnområden under en Azure-prenumeration.

Visa en lista över alla namnområden under en Azure-prenumeration.

list_by_subscription(filter: str | None = None, top: int | None = None, **kwargs: Any) -> Iterable[Namespace]

Parametrar

filter
str
Obligatorisk

Frågan som används för att filtrera sökresultaten med OData-syntax. Filtrering tillåts endast för egenskapen "name" och med ett begränsat antal OData-åtgärder. Dessa åtgärder är: funktionen "contains" samt följande logiska åtgärder: inte, och eller eq (för lika med) och ne (för inte lika med). Inga aritmetiska åtgärder stöds. Följande är ett giltigt filterexempel: $filter=contains(namE, 'PATTERN') och name ne 'PATTERN-1'. Följande är inte ett giltigt filterexempel: $filter=location eq 'westus'. Standardvärdet är Ingen.

top
int
Obligatorisk

Antalet resultat som ska returneras per sida för liståtgärden. Giltigt intervall för den översta parametern är 1 till 100. Om inget anges är standardantalet resultat som ska returneras 20 objekt per sida. Standardvärdet är Ingen.

cls
callable

En anpassad typ eller funktion som skickas direktsvaret

Returer

En iterator som en instans av antingen Namnområde eller resultatet av cls(response)

Returtyp

Undantag

list_shared_access_keys

Listnycklar för ett namnområde.

Visa en lista över de två nycklar som används för att publicera till ett namnområde.

list_shared_access_keys(resource_group_name: str, namespace_name: str, **kwargs: Any) -> NamespaceSharedAccessKeys

Parametrar

resource_group_name
str
Obligatorisk

Namnet på resursgruppen i användarens prenumeration. Krävs.

namespace_name
str
Obligatorisk

Namn på namnområdet. Krävs.

cls
callable

En anpassad typ eller funktion som skickas direktsvaret

Returer

NamespaceSharedAccessKeys eller resultatet av cls(response)

Returtyp

Undantag

Attribut

models

models = <module 'azure.mgmt.eventgrid.models' from 'C:\\hostedtoolcache\\windows\\Python\\3.11.7\\x64\\Lib\\site-packages\\azure\\mgmt\\eventgrid\\models\\__init__.py'>